Session Description:
Water management faces a quickly evolving landscape, with climate change and related shifts in drought and flood severity, frequency, and duration; land use change; technological advances; and changes in water use and demand.  Each of these is rife with uncertainty and wide variation over space and time.  Long-term infrastructure and management decisions need to be made in the face of both deep uncertainty and non-stationarity.  How can we consider these changes while ensuring that water resource and flood protection systems are resilient, robust, and suitable for the requirements of the end user? This session will explore tools for characterising and assessing water systems at local through to continental scales for the purposes of informing planning and decision making, while considering climate, environmental, and societal changes that will impact system risks, resilience, and robustness.
